I still like the game and wager on a frequent basis. Over this time period I have gambled on a variation of vingt-et-un called "The Take it Leave it Method". You most certainly will not get rich with this tactic or defeat the casino, nonetheless you will have an abundance of fun. This tactic is founded on the fact that vingt-et-un seems to be a game of runs. When you are on fire your on fire, and when you are not you’re NOT!

I play basic strategy chemin de fer. When I don’t win I wager the lowest amount allowed on the subsequent hand. If I do not win again I bet the table minimum on the subsequent hand again etc. As soon as I profit I take the payout paid to me and I bet the original wager again. If I win this hand I then keep in play the winnings paid to me and now have double my original wager on the table. If I win again I take the winnings paid to me, and if I win the next hand I leave it for a total of four times my original wager. I keep wagering this way "Take it Leave it etc". Once I lose I return the action back down to the original value.
